This isn't a criticism more an observation but on reading the Herald today it appears that Steve and Deano have been 'co-opted' on the board and are not investors I was always under the impression that they'd put their own money in with the rest of the consortium but this doesn't appear to be the case.

Have I read the article wrong ?

That's how I understand it. They were/are the public face of the consortium/board but haven't actually bought any shares. They have been employed in roles that have a place at the table in board meetings.

I don't want to be negative, or start a flame war. I would just like some discussion....

I have some reservations with the new setup.

Dean Edwards has been appointed the Director Of Football. On the face of it this role is to take care of the day to day running of the footballing side of the business. With the youth team disbanded and no reserve team on the horizon and a manager put in charge of the first team what exactly will Deano be doing besides acting as a chief scout?

I have never had the pleasure of meeting Steve Breed but I am sure he is a great guy and obviously a great cheerleader for the club. I'm seeing lots of people praising his energy and enthusiasm which are both important attributes to bring to the role of Chief Executive, however I am concerned whether he has the required business acumen, nous or experience for such an important role being in charge of the day to day running of the business as a whole.
I am aware he ran the travel scheme and he may well have other, more relevant experience but nothing that seems to have been publicised.
